I'm hoping this is something simple that I've overlooked...

Installed OpsCenter for a customer, 7.7.2 on a Win 2012 R2 VM on a VMWare host, and I'm trying to connect to a Master running NBU 7.7.2 also on Win 2012 R2, in the same VMware environment. They are on the same domain, can ping each other, have port 1556 listening, I have tried with the OpsCenter server in and not in the Additional Servers on the host properties in the NBU Admin console.

I have not yet managed to connect the master so there is nothing yet in OpsCenter, but the error I get is 

 

OpsCenter-10940:An unknown error has occurred while discovering master server. Please contact your system administrator.

When 13724 is not open inbound on the master, you get a Opscenter-10940 error.
